The median expected salary for a typical Bond Sales Manager
in the United States is $116,025. This basic
market pricing report was prepared using our Certified Compensation Professionals'
analysis of survey data collected from thousands of HR departments at employers
of all sizes, industries and geographies.
|
|
Source: HR Reported data as of May 2013

Job Description for Bond Sales Manager

Manages and leads a group of bond sales officers. Develops marketing and sales initiatives to increase profitability. Oversees the buying and selling of government or corporate bonds and securities. Advises clients on investment options; monitors market conditions to maximize profits for customers and the institution. Requires a bachelor's degree in a related area and at least 7 years of experience in the field. Familiar with a variety of the field's concepts, practices, and procedures. Relies on extensive exper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als. Performs a variety of tasks. Leads and directs the work of others. A wide degree of creativity and latitude is expected. Typically reports to a director.
